Beside this, what does US Steel make?

In addition to steel, United States Steel is one of North America‘s top two makers of tin mill products, primarily for the container industry. United States Steel is active in virtually every activity connected with the production of steel, including the mining of iron ore and coal, coke production, and transportation.

How do I calculate my US pension?

Multiply $60,000 times 1.5 percent and then multiply by the 30 years of service. The annual pension amount comes to $27,000. This will be paid in monthly installments. In this example, the employee will get a monthly pension of $2,250.

How are lump sum pension payouts calculated?

To calculate your percentage, take your monthly pension amount and multiply it by 12, then divide that total by the lump sum. Consider the following scenario. Your pension is $1,000 per month for life or a $160,000 buyout. Do the math ($1,000 x 12 = $12,000/$160,000), and you get 7.5%.

What is the present value of my pension?

Present value is calculated as PV = FV / (1 + i)^n, where the present value equals the future value divided by one plus the expected interest rate over “n” number of years. You can see right away that the first thing I needed to know was the future value of the pension in 2046.

What is the largest steel mill in the world?

In the late 19th and early 20th centuries the world’s largest steel mill was the Barrow Hematite Steel Company steelworks located in Barrow-in-Furness, United Kingdom. Today, the world’s largest steel mill is in Gwangyang, South Korea.
